Default Blue Pipes

Before the flames start, I did try to search on this, but couldn't find anything for my situation.

I'm the 2nd owner of this bike, and was told it has a Stage1 upgrade, and I do have the SERT that was provided to me with the bike. The pipes around the collector for the 2-1-2 exhaust are blue behind the heat shields. Is this normal, or should I bring the bike into the dealer to check the tune? I have about a month of warrentee left, so I need to get this taken care of now if there is an issue.

The pipes are not hard chrome coated like the mufflers are so blueing is normal and usually happens within a few miles on the odometer. Now if you change the pipes to a full chrome set and get blueing then you have a problem! Ride and enjoy, your scoot is fine.
